Configuring TwonkyVision on a LaCie MiniNAS

Derived from this forum post that solved the problem for me.
Sometimes (most of the time) the limited configuration for TwonkyVision that the MiniNAS config pages gives you isn’t enough. Trying to go to http://yournas:9000 results in the red error page. Apparently LaCie thinks they know better than their users.
To enable TwonkyVision config, upload this signed patch file (mirrored here, in case the original source goes away) in the Configuration page of the MiniNAS config, as an update.
Tested with 1.1.2.1 of the MiniNAS firmware.
